微波EDA网,见证研发工程师的成长!
首页 > 研发问答 > 微电子和IC设计 > IC后端设计交流 > dc综合后fm通不过怎么办

dc综合后fm通不过怎么办

时间:10-02 整理:3721RD 点击:
dc综合后网表输入到fm,加了.svf提示有unmatch point,报的是congstant reg,这个问题怎么弄?dc脚本里没什么约束都是写时序上的简单约束啊,求问大神,谢谢

有可能是设计问题,你检查下设计;
如果你的设计综合时是分模块综合的,记得把所有的.svf都加上

把constant reg 在综合时keep住,再试试

怎么keep?求指点

compile 前对register设size only

有可能dc优化成tie 1 FV认为是0, 多半是rtl coding 的问题。有冗余无效逻辑。

要保持常量寄存器不被优化可以在DC里用compile_seqmap_propagate_high_effort这个变量控制。但这个通常只影响FM的Equality模式,默认模式是可以过的。

weiguan

Copyright © 2017-2020 微波EDA网 版权所有

网站地图

Top